ånga

Etymology

edit

The oblique case of ånge (in Early Modern Swedish), from Old Swedish ange. Compare Old Norse ang (fragrance) and Old Norse anga (to exhale; to emit fragrance).

Beyond the Nordic languages the origin is unclear, perhaps from Proto-Indo-European *h₂enh₁- (to breathe).

Noun

edit

ånga c

  1. steam
  2. vapour/vapor
